I am an electrical engineer, specializing in Micro-Electromechanical Systems, who works for the Jet Propulsion Laboratory. I am also working towards my PhD at UCLA. I received my BSEE in 1994 and my MSEE in 1996, both from UCLA. My research is focused in a couple of areas. I am developing a resonant mechanical magnetic sensor made in a standard CMOS process. Also, I am characterizing a new thick film called SU-8 which has the potential to simplify micro-molding technology. At JPL I work at the Micro Devices Laboratory and am in the LIGA group working on many projects utilizing thick films as well as traditional LIGA.
